🧠💓 Just read a fascinating new study in Cell Metabolism (July 2025): dislocation of hexokinase 1 from mitochondria increases O-GlcNAcylation in endothelial cells — a hidden driver of HFpEF!
Reversing this sugar-tagging with OGA overexpression or OGT inhibition restores heart function in mice. Precision metabolism meets cardiology. 🔬❤️🔥
